Wolverhampton Wanderers played a goalless draw at Molineux as they hosted Leicester City on Friday, February 14.
After the game, Wolves midfielder Leander Dendoncker spoke out on the draw as he said that Wolves "deserved to win".
“It was a good game. We scored and then it’s cancelled again – it’s not the first time – but I think we played a good game, especially first-half," Dendoncker told
Wolves official website.
“We had everything under control and I think over the whole game they didn’t have a lot of chances, because Leicester are still a very good team. I think we had the better chances and we deserved to win today.
“We controlled them really well because they are really dangerous when they get into their game, but we didn’t let them in their game.
“We’ve had a couple of chances at the end as well; I think Raul had two chances, Adama had one as well.”
